Understanding Backlinks

What are Backlinks?

Backlinks, also known as inbound or incoming links, are hyperlinks on external websites that lead to your website. Essentially, they are references from one webpage to another. These links are essential because search engines like Google view them as votes of confidence. In other words, when reputable websites link to your content, it signals to search engines that your content is valuable and trustworthy.

The Impact of Backlinks on SEO

Backlinks play a pivotal role in SEO for several reasons:

  • Improved Search Engine Rankings: Websites with a higher number of quality backlinks tend to rank higher in search engine results pages (SERPs). Search engines see these links as a sign of authority and relevance.
  • Increased Organic Traffic: High-quality backlinks can drive targeted organic traffic to your website. When users click on these links, they are likely interested in the content you offer.
  • Enhanced Domain Authority: Backlinks contribute to your website's domain authority, a metric that measures your site's overall credibility. As your domain authority increases, your chances of ranking for competitive keywords also improve.
  • Faster Indexing: Search engines often discover new content through backlinks. When reputable websites link to your site, it can lead to faster indexing and better visibility in search results.

Tips for Utilizing Free Backlink Sites

To maximize the benefits of free backlink sites, consider the following tips:
  • Focus on Quality: While the sites are free, prioritize quality over quantity. Seek backlinks from reputable websites with relevant content to your niche.
  • Diversify Anchor Text: Use a variety of anchor text to make your backlink profile appear natural to search engines.
  • Regularly Update Content: Ensure that the content on your website is up-to-date and valuable to encourage other websites to link to you.
  • Monitor Backlinks: Keep track of your backlinks and regularly check for broken or toxic links using SEO tools.
  • Engage in Guest Posting: Many free backlink sites offer opportunities for guest posting. Write high-quality articles to build backlinks and establish your expertise in your field.

Q3. What is the difference between a high-quality backlink and a low-quality backlink? 
A. High-quality backlinks come from reputable, authoritative websites in your niche and provide relevant and valuable content to users. Low-quality backlinks, on the other hand, often come from spammy or unrelated websites and can harm your SEO efforts.
